Zurück   IP-Symcon Community Forum > IP-Symcon 2.x > Allgemeine Diskussion

Antwort
 
LinkBack Themen-Optionen Thema durchsuchen
  #1 (permalink)  
Alt 29.06.08, 11:55
Senior Member
 
Registriert seit: Jan 2006
Beiträge: 198
Standard 1-Wire Probleme

1-Wire Probleme

In der "alten Version" werden bei mir alle 1-Wire Module abgefragt. Darunter sind unter anderem auch mehrere DS2408 Module mit denen werden Meldungen ausgegeben.

Ich wollte nun das Gleiche mal unter der V2.0 nachbauen. Doch hier bekomme nach 30 Sekunden einen

"Fatal error" mit der Meldung Maximum execution time of 30 seconds exceeded in C:\IP-Symcon\scripts\43690.ips.php on line 63

Die Line - Nummer kann unterschiedlich sein!!!

Habe auch mehrere Module unter einander ausgetauscht. Oder ein Module mehrere Male abgefragt. Doch nach 30 Sekunden tritt dieser Fehler immer wieder auf.

Kann es sein, dass, wenn die abgesetzten Befehle länger als 30 Sekunden dauern, diese Fehlermeldung auftaucht.

Nun, bei mir dauert beim Start von IPS, dieser Vorgang über 4 Minuten und bei der V1.0 gibt es hier keine Probleme

anbei die Demo - scripts und ein Bild mit der Meldung

Gruß
Luggi
Anhänge, die auf Freischaltung warten
Dateityp: zip Fehlermeldung.zip
Mit Zitat antworten
  #2 (permalink)  
Alt 29.06.08, 12:09
Benutzerbild von paresy
Administrator
 
Registriert seit: Feb 2005
Ort: Sarkwitz
Beiträge: 6,370
Standard

Unter V2 wartet das Skript bis der Befehl wirklich über den Bus gegangen ist, damit du eine wirkliche Rückmeldung bekommst. Das kann bei sehr vielen Befehlen natürlich länger als 30Sek dauern.

Du müsstest einfach die Max Execution Time für das Skript erhöhen.

paresy
Mit Zitat antworten
  #3 (permalink)  
Alt 29.06.08, 13:12
Senior Member
 
Registriert seit: Jan 2006
Beiträge: 198
Standard

Zitat:
Zitat von paresy Beitrag anzeigen
Unter V2 wartet das Skript bis der Befehl wirklich über den Bus gegangen ist, damit du eine wirkliche Rückmeldung bekommst. Das kann bei sehr vielen Befehlen natürlich länger als 30Sek dauern.

Du müsstest einfach die Max Execution Time für das Skript erhöhen.

paresy
Wie erhöhe ich dir "Max Execution Time" unter V2.0?

Gruß
Luggi
Mit Zitat antworten
  #4 (permalink)  
Alt 29.06.08, 13:27
Benutzerbild von paresy
Administrator
 
Registriert seit: Feb 2005
Ort: Sarkwitz
Beiträge: 6,370
Standard

Eine php.ini erstellen mit z.B. folgendem Inhalt:

Code:
[PHP]
max_execution_time = 300
oder im direkt über: http://de3.php.net/set_time_limit

paresy
Mit Zitat antworten
  #5 (permalink)  
Alt 30.06.08, 06:41
Senior Member
 
Registriert seit: Jan 2006
Beiträge: 198
Standard

Danke! Kann es sein, dass die V2.0 "langsamer" die Befehle von 1-wire abarbeitet? Der Rechner ist der Gleiche.
Gruß
Luggi

Geändert von Luggi (30.06.08 um 07:00 Uhr)
Mit Zitat antworten
Antwort

Themen-Optionen Thema durchsuchen
Thema durchsuchen:

Erweiterte Suche

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are an


Ähnliche Themen
Thema Autor Forum Antworten Letzter Beitrag
Probleme bei US-Sensor über ComPort jolentes Allgemeine Diskussion 6 23.08.09 15:15
Probleme mit Sendern FS20 Peloponnisos Sonstige Funkkomponenten / Wetterstationen 1 03.12.07 18:10
Anfaengerfrage 1 wire StephanBonn 1-Wire, M-BUS 13 03.10.07 20:17
probleme mit sessions pleibling Allgemeine Diskussion 12 27.04.07 23:19
Probleme mit SQL-Abfrage H-MAN Scripte, PHP, SQL 10 20.10.06 19:04


Alle Zeitangaben in WEZ +1. Es ist jetzt 09:31 Uhr.


Powered by vBulletin® Version 3.8.4 (Deutsch)
Copyright ©2000 - 2012, Jelsoft Enterprises Ltd.
Content Relevant URLs by vBSEO 3.6.0